Background Story
I grew up in Cornwall in the UK, but later studied art in Edinburgh, Scotland which is about as far away as you can get within the UK. However, the travel bug came early and I went backpacking to South Africa in 1994 and never looked back.
The sailing bug came later when I met my future husband in 2003. He was living on his boat in Cape Town at this time and what girl can refuse a first date of dinner on a yacht? The rest as they say is history. He taught me to sail which I took to like a duck to water, and I opened my own yacht brokerage in Cape Town.
Soon afterwards we became a yacht delivery team, with just the two of us involved in delivering yachts from 36’ – 48’ all over the world. I have sailed across the Atlantic, and the Indian Ocean many times, and I’ve been lucky enough to go through the Panama Canal twice after picking up two different yachts in the Caribbean to sail to Australia.
In 2018 I began writing freelance professionally which also helped to subsidise my travels. And in 2019 we bought our own yacht, a Catalina 36, in California and took a leisurely cruise across the Pacific to Australia.

Yachting Experience
Jo was the owner/broker of a successful yacht brokerage in Cape Town (Sail Away Yachts) before she started delivering yachts with her husband in 2007. Together they run the yacht delivery company Indigo Yacht Management, which specializes in long-distance yacht deliveries.
